Gallery Gothic Architecture. The rebirth of Gothic architecture began in the United Kingdom in the late 1700s. Gothic Revival also referred to as Victorian Gothic neo-Gothic or Gothick is an architectural movement that began in the late 1740s in England. Gothic architecture architectural style in Europe that lasted from the mid-12th century to the 16th century particularly a style of masonry building characterized by cavernous spaces with the expanse of walls broken up by overlaid tracery. It superceded Romanesque architecture and. Some of its distinctive features include loftiness and an intricate and delicate aesthetic.
